Project Overview
This is the documentation site for Telecontrol SCADA (ОИК Телеконтроль), a Russian-language industrial control system. The site is built with Jekyll and hosted on GitHub Pages using the Just the Docs theme via jekyll-remote-theme.
All documentation content is written in Russian.
Local Development
bundle install # Install dependencies
bundle exec jekyll serve # Serve locally (default: http://localhost:4000)

Front Matter Conventions
Each page must have:
---
title: <Russian display title shown in nav and as <h1>>
nav_order: <integer ordering within its level>
permalink: /<url-path> # optional but recommended
---
For pages with children, add has_children: true. Child pages reference their parent by title:
---
title: График
nav_order: 1
parent: Клиент
permalink: /client/graph
---

Search
Client-side search via Lunr is enabled in _config.yml. The tokenizer is configured to split on whitespace and punctuation so Cyrillic queries work.
Screenshots under img/
Most images under img/ are produced by an offline screenshot generator that lives in the scada-client repo (client/app/screenshot_generator.cpp). Every file in img/ is tagged in ../client/docs/image_manifest.json with one of:
auto-view— main-window view; generator renders it via aWindowInforegistered with the controller registry.auto-dialog— modal dialog rendered by the generator’s dialog pipeline.auto-menu— right-click / popup menu rendered from the command registries.auto-state— device / node state capture (online, offline, …).manual-diagram— hand-drawn architecture or protocol diagram.manual-modus— Modus schematic; depends on the ActiveX runtime the offline fixture doesn’t have.manual-os— OS-level screenshot (e.g. Windows firewall).obsolete— no longer referenced from any page; removal candidate.
Regenerating auto images
From a scada-client checkout:
cmd.exe /c "cd /d C:\tc\scada && cmake --build --preset release-dev --target screenshot_generator"
cmd.exe /c C:\tc\scada\client\update_scada_docs_screenshots.cmd
For now the script updates only the current approved rollout subset: client-login.png, client-retransmission.png, graph-cursor.png, and users.png.
Then git diff img/ in scada-docs to review the changes before committing.
